Steering Control Headlight System

Sagar Sanjay Dawange, Vijay P. Satao

Abstract


The subject of this task is steering controlled (or directional) headlights, that are typically a different arrangement of headlights fitted to street vehicle other than the standard low bar/high pillar headlights and there highlights is that they turn with the controlling, so the driver of the vehicle can see the curve, what he is really transforming into. These kind of headlights showed up on generation around these days, however not famous, in spite of the fact that they make night time driver more secure. The most renowned car which includes this light was the Citroen DS, presented by the Paris Motor Show.. The headlights can be associated with the steering linkage by method for roads or cables, worked using pressurized water by the force guiding or these days electronically balanced, even constrained by the satellite route framework. We make new and current Directional Headlights in effective way by expanding the light angle. Directional headlights are those headlights that give improved lighting particularly by cornering. There are autos that have their headlights legitimately associated with the steering mechanism so its lights will follow the development of the front wheels.
